TECHNICAL FIELD
[0001] The application belongs to the field of steel wire mesh frame insulation board production equipment, and particularly relates to a vertical wire inserting machine. BACKGROUND
[0002] The steel wire mesh frame insulation board is provided with a steel wire mesh frame on both sides of a polystyrene board, and a plurality of wires are inserted into the polystyrene board and welded with the steel wire mesh frame to connect and fix the steel wire mesh frame and the polystyrene board. When the wires are inserted into the steel wire mesh frame, a wire inserting machine needs to be used for work.
[0003] The patent with the publication number CN222902491U discloses a stand-type wire inserting machine, which comprises a base frame, a inserting plate and a plurality of groups of wire inserting devices. The wire inserting device comprises a wire adjusting device, a wire feeding device and a pipe inserting device arranged in sequence. A wire cutting device is arranged between the wire feeding device and the pipe inserting device. The wire cutting device is provided with a plurality of wire cutting sleeves arranged on the wire cutting plate. The wire cutting plate is driven by the driving device to move up and down, so that the steel wires in the plurality of wire inserting devices can be cut at the same time. The structure is simple, and the wire cutting efficiency is higher. However, the technical solution of the patent can realize the straightening of the steel wire by the self-provided wire adjusting device. However, the structure is simple, and it is difficult to realize the straightening of the thicker steel wire. Moreover, only the steel wire with a fixed length can be cut, and the length of the cut steel wire cannot be adjusted according to the actual processing requirement. The steel wire mesh frame insulation board with different steel wire lengths cannot be processed, and the universality is poor. SUMMARY
[0004] The technical problem to be solved by the application is to provide a vertical wire inserting machine, which can adjust the length of the wire box according to the length of the steel wire and can be applied to the production of insulation boards with different steel wire lengths.
[0005] The technical solution adopted by the application is as follows: A vertical wire inserting machine comprises a fixed plate, a wire box arranged on the fixed plate, a inserting needle for pushing out the steel wire in the wire box, and a inserting needle driving device for driving the inserting needle to move. The wire box comprises inclined surfaces arranged on the left and right sides, end plates arranged on the front and back sides, guide grooves arranged below the two inclined surfaces, and an adjusting plate arranged between the two inclined surfaces. The shape of the adjusting plate corresponds to the shape formed by the two inclined surfaces and the guide grooves. The inserting needle is installed at the bottom of the guide groove and is used to push out the lowermost steel wire. A screw rod is installed on the adjusting plate and is connected to the end plate through a nut.
[0006] Further, inner side plates and outer side plates are arranged below the two inclined surfaces respectively, a gap between the inner side plates and the outer side plates forms a guide groove for vertically arranging the inserted wires, the outer side plate comprises an upper outer side plate and a lower outer side plate fixedly connected with the inclined surfaces, an outer side upper end of the lower outer side plate is connected with the upper outer side plate through a rotating shaft, the lower outer side plate is connected with the end plate through a pin shaft, and the upper outer side plate is fixedly connected with the corresponding inclined surface.
[0007] Further, the guide groove is open at the bottom, a protruding part is arranged on the inserted pin and passes through the opening upwards, and the protruding part pushes the lowermost steel wire.
[0008] Further, bottom plates are fixedly connected below the inner side plates and the outer side plates, and the opening at the bottom of the guide groove is located between the two bottom plates.
[0009] Further, a limiting slide for supporting the inserted pin is arranged below the guide groove.
[0010] Further, rotating shafts with gear teeth are arranged in the inner side plates and the outer side plates and located at the left and right sides of the guide groove, and the rotating directions of the two rotating shafts are the same.
[0011] Further, the two ends of the rotating shaft are mounted on the end plate, a connecting rod is arranged at one end of the rotating shaft, a transverse connecting rod is arranged on the outer connecting rod, the upper ends of the two connecting rods are connected with a fork plate through rotating shafts, and the other end of the connecting rod is connected with a driving rod through a rotating shaft. The upper end of the driving rod is connected with the piston rod of the air cylinder A through a swing rod.
[0012] Further, a steel pipe is arranged on the end plate located at the front side and corresponding to the lower end of the guide groove.
[0013] Further, a plurality of wire boxes are arranged along the height direction of the fixed plate, and each wire box is provided with one inserted pin. The inserted pin driving device comprises a sliding rail fixedly arranged on the fixed plate, a push-pull rod arranged on the sliding rail, a servo motor arranged on the fixed plate, a lead screw arranged on the output shaft of the servo motor, and a lead screw nut arranged on the push-pull rod and matched with the lead screw.
[0014] Further, the upper and lower ends of the fixed plate are connected with corresponding upper and lower fixed plates through guide rails respectively, a rack is arranged on the lower fixed plate, a gear driven by a motor is arranged on the fixed plate, and the rack is matched with the gear. A bottom fixed plate is arranged below the lower fixed plate, one end of the lower fixed plate is rotatably connected with the bottom fixed plate through a lock shaft, and a cylinder B is arranged between the other end of the lower fixed plate and the bottom fixed plate.
[0015] The positive effects of the application are as follows: The present invention has an adjustment plate in the wire box, which can be adjusted according to the length of the steel wire to accommodate the wire insertion operation of steel wires of different lengths. The guide groove arranges the steel wires vertically, and then the insertion pin enters from the rear of the wire box and moves in a straight line to the front end to push out the bottom steel wire in the guide groove, thus completing the automatic wire insertion operation.
[0016] Meanwhile, the lower outer panel of the wire box can be opened. When the wire gets stuck, the problematic wire can be directly removed by opening the lower outer panel, enabling emergency handling of wire box malfunctions. Attached Figure Description

Detailed Implementation
[0018] As attached Figures 1-7 The present invention discloses a vertical wire insertion machine, including a vertically arranged fixed plate 1, a wire box 7 arranged on the front side of the fixed plate 1, a insertion pin 4 for pushing out the steel wire 28 in the wire box 7, and an insertion pin driving device for driving the insertion pin 4 to move.
[0019] Several wire boxes 7 are arranged along the height direction of the fixed plate 1. In this embodiment, there are 6 wire boxes 7, but the number can be set according to actual needs. Each wire box 7 is provided with a corresponding pin 4, and they can share a pin drive device to drive the pin 4 to move.
[0020] As attached Figures 3-7As shown, the wire box 7 includes two inclined surfaces 30 on the left and right sides, end plates on the front and back sides, a guide groove arranged below the bottom of the two inclined surfaces 30, and an adjusting plate 21 arranged between the two inclined surfaces 30. The two inclined surfaces 30 and the two end plates form a wire box compartment for placing the straightened steel wire. The width of the guide groove can only accommodate one steel wire, and the steel wire is arranged vertically in the guide groove. The position of the pin 4 corresponds to the position of the lowermost steel wire in the guide groove. When the pin 4 moves forward, it pushes the steel wire forward to complete the wire insertion work. The adjusting plate 21 has a shape consistent with the shape formed by the two inclined surfaces 30 and the guide groove. A screw rod 22 is installed on the adjusting plate 21, and the adjusting plate 21 is connected to the end plate on the rear side through a nut. The position of the adjusting plate 21 can be adjusted according to the length of the steel wire to adapt to steel wires of different lengths. A steel pipe 8 is arranged at the front end of the wire box 7. The pushed-out steel wire passes through the steel pipe 8 and is completely pushed out.
[0021] As shown in the accompanying drawings, Figure 5 , 6 As shown in the accompanying drawings, an inner side plate 29 and an outer side plate are arranged below the two inclined surfaces 30. The gap between the inner side plate 29 and the outer side plate forms a guide groove, and the inner bottom of the inner side plate 29 and the outer side plate is inwardly tapered to hold the steel wire 28 and prevent it from falling. The inner side plate 29 is fixedly connected to the fixed plate 1, and the front and back end plates are fixedly connected to the front and back ends of the inner side plate 29. The outer side plate includes an upper outer side plate 19 and a lower outer side plate 23. The upper outer side plate 19 is fixedly connected to the corresponding inclined surface 30, and the lower outer side plate 23 is rotatably connected to the upper outer side plate 19 through a rotating shaft. Pins 25 are arranged between the two ends of the lower outer side plate 23 and the corresponding end plates. When the steel wire 28 in the guide groove is stuck, the pins 25 are removed, and the lower outer side plate 23 can be rotated around the rotating shaft to open the guide groove, and the problem steel wire 28 can be removed. In the traditional design, the wire box is not detachable, and when a problem occurs, the steel wire in the guide groove can only be lifted out by using a screwdriver or other tools, which is time-consuming and laborious.
[0022] As shown in the accompanying drawings, Figure 3As shown, in this embodiment, the upper outer side plate 19 and the lower outer side plate 23 are both block-shaped and there are several of them. The several upper outer side plates 19 are all set on the bottom surface of the corresponding inclined surface 30, and the multiple upper outer side plates 19 are connected together by a connecting shaft 20. The two ends of the connecting shaft 20 are fixedly connected to the end plates at the front and rear ends of the wire box 7. A lower outer side plate 23 is set on each upper outer side plate 19. The contact surface between the upper outer side plate 19 and the lower outer side plate 23 is a plane. The pivot between the upper and lower outer side plates is located outside the contact surface, and a bottom plate 24 is provided below the lower outer side plate 23. The several lower outer side plates 23 are fixedly connected to the bottom plate 24. A pin 25 is provided between the lower outer side plates 23 at both ends and the corresponding end plates. In order to reduce weight, the inner side plate 29 can also be set as several blocks, and a bottom plate is also set below it. In this case, the inner side plate 29, the lower outer side plate 23, and the two bottom plates 24 (or may also include the upper outer side plate 19) together form a guide groove. The bottom of the inner side of the base plate 24 tapers inward, but there is still an opening between the two, but this opening is smaller than the diameter of the steel wire to prevent the steel wire from falling off.
[0023] In this embodiment, the main body of the insert wire 4 is located below the guide groove. The insert wire 4 has a protrusion that extends upward through the opening. This protrusion is used to contact the lowest steel wire in the guide groove and push it forward.
[0024] To prevent the pin 4 from shifting position during movement, a V-shaped limiting slide 26 is provided below the guide groove, along which the pin 4 moves. The limiting slide 26 is also located between the two end plates, and its position should be reasonably set so as not to hinder the deflection of the lower outer plate 23.
[0025] As attached Figure 1 , 3 As shown in Figures 5 and 6, to ensure that the steel wire 28 can smoothly enter the guide groove, toothed shafts 27 are provided on both sides of the entrance of the guide groove. The two shafts 27 rotate in the same direction, one guiding the wire into the guide groove and the other guiding it outward, which helps the steel wire 28 to fall into the guide groove one by one. Both ends of the shaft 27 are set on the end plate. A connecting rod 18 is installed at the rear end of the shaft 27 and on the outside of the end plate. A transverse connecting rod 16 is provided on the connecting rod 18 of the outer shaft 27. The upper ends of the two connecting rods 18 are connected to the fork plate 17 through a rotating shaft, and the other end of the connecting rod 16 is connected to the drive rod 6 through a rotating shaft. The upper end of the drive rod 6 is connected to the piston rod of the vertically mounted cylinder A via a swing rod 31. Cylinder A is mounted on the fixed plate 1. The up-and-down movement of its piston rod drives the drive rod 6 to move up and down (and also left and right simultaneously), causing the connecting rod 18 on the winch 27 to swing synchronously, thus causing the corresponding winch 27 to swing synchronously and allowing the steel wire 28 to enter the guide groove. By extending the length of the drive rod 6 to connect it to the connecting rod 18 on each wire box, synchronous swinging of the winch 27 in multiple wire boxes can be achieved.
[0026] As attached Figure 1 As shown, the pin drive device includes slide rails 3 at the upper and lower ends of the fixed plate 1, push-pull rods 2 between the two slide rails 3, servo motors 13 on the fixed plate 1, and lead screws 5 on the output shaft of the servo motors 13. A lead screw nut that matches the lead screw 5 is provided on the push-pull rods 2.
[0027] Meanwhile, the upper and lower ends of the fixing plate 1 are connected to the corresponding upper fixing plate and lower fixing plate 9 via guide rails. A rack 10 is provided on the lower fixing plate 9, and a motor-driven gear 11 is provided on the fixing plate 1. The gear 11 cooperates with the rack 10 to achieve the forward and backward feeding of the fixing plate 1 along the guide rails. A bottom fixing plate 12 is provided below the lower fixing plate 9. One end of the lower fixing plate 9 is rotatably connected to the bottom fixing plate 12 via a locking shaft, and a cylinder B14 is provided between the other end of the lower fixing plate 9 and the bottom fixing plate 12. Driven by the cylinder B14, the angle of the fixing plate 1 can be adjusted, thereby adjusting the thread insertion angle.
[0028] In use, the straightened steel wire 28 is placed into the wire box 7. The position of the fixing plate 1 is first adjusted by the cylinder B14 and the gear rack 11, moving the wire box 7 to the designated position. The rotation of the winch 27 allows the steel wires to sequentially enter the lower guide groove within the wire box. The guide groove is only wide enough to accommodate one wire. A pin 4 is located at the bottom of the guide groove, entering from the rear of the wire box and moving linearly to the front, simultaneously pushing out the bottommost steel wire 28 from the guide groove. The pin 4 then retracts, causing the remaining steel wires in the guide groove to descend, while another steel wire, through the winch 27, enters the space vacated in the guide groove. This completes one cycle.
[0029] Meanwhile, the lower part of the wire box is equipped with a rotatable lower outer plate 23, which is normally fixed by a pin 25 to prevent it from rotating freely. When the wire box malfunctions, the pin 25 can be pulled out, the lower outer plate 23 can be rotated open, and the problematic wire can be directly removed, enabling emergency handling of wire box malfunctions.
